treatise

[US]/ˈtriːtɪs/
[UK]/ˈtriːtɪs/
Frequency: Very High

Translation

n. a written work dealing formally and systematically with a subject, often in the form of a book; a treatise offers a detailed explanation or analysis of a specific topic.
